當前位置:首頁 » 編程語言 » js獲取php數據

js獲取php數據

發布時間: 2024-09-16 23:55:19

⑴ js如何獲取php中的變數

js獲取php中變數,一般使用ajax,php端直接echo字元串就可以。

⑵ 在JS如何獲取PHP的值這當中應注意什麼

js獲取不了php的值。至少我是沒發現有相關功能的,但是php卻可以向js賦值。
php是服務端代碼,js是客戶端代碼。
所有的js都可以由php定義,了解這個就簡單了。
如php中寫:
$word = '你好';
echo "<script> var test = '".$word."'; </script>";
如此,html頁面就會獲得一個js如下,
<script> var test = '你好';</script>
而這個js中的變數test就是php中$word這個參數的值。

⑶ 同一php文件中,如何將Js代碼中的變數,傳遞到php代碼中。

你沒理解 js/php 運行時的順序和邏輯.
js僅在 瀏覽器中運行.
php 僅在伺服器端運行.
2者交互, 通常通過 http get/post 協議進行交互.

因此, 要將 js 變數傳輸到 php, 需通過 get/post 將參數傳入.
譬如:
<script>
function test(){
var x="abc";
$.ajax("test.php?x="+x);
}
</script>

而 test.php 中, 通過 $_REQUEST["x"] 即可拿到js 請求過來的變數.

⑷ PHP與JS對接的問題,有前端頁面(html的)和後端頁面(PHP的),JS怎麼獲取後台數組

這個當然是推薦ajax操作:
前端:
$.ajax({ url: "api.php", success: function(res){
for(var i in res){
$('#id').append(res[i])

}
}
});

後台 echo json_encode($array)

⑸ js和php在同一個文件中相互獲取值的問題

你好php是服務端腳本語言,js是瀏覽器端腳本語老漏言,除非使用滾慎ajax進行數據提交否則,一但服務端生成好頁面傳到瀏覽器端後就不再參與瀏覽器端的「運算」,所以你想在同一個頁面中不重新進行請求就js和php相互獲取值是不現實的。

另:

你的代碼分析如下:

<script>

varlinka;

linka=window.location.href;

</script>

<?php

$ch[0]="<script>document.write(linka);</script>";

echo$ch[0]."<br/>";

<script>

到這步為止,php獲得js的變數非常順利

下面侍備爛接著

<script>

vark;

k="<?phpecho$ch[0];?>";

alert(k);

</script>

其實你的整個頁面都是php的,執行

$ch[0]="<script>document.write(linka);</script>";

這一句的時候,php的$ch[0]僅僅只是被賦予了"<script>document.write(linka);</script>"這個字元串,js代碼並沒有運行.php也並沒有獲得js的變數!獲得的只是字元串而已.

⑹ 不用ajax,在js中如何獲取PHP中的session值

我可不可這么理解你的要求: 1.默認是需要驗證的:2.php驗證; 2.符合條件的就不需要驗證了,直接看到了主體內容:index.php 即然要判斷用戶需不需要驗證,那麼在index.php之前是不是還有一個頁面呢?在這個頁面里POST 隱藏控制項傳參到index.php, if($_POST('hidden') == "OK") { ... } else { header("Location: 2.php"); } 設SESSION很簡單了,跟定義變數一樣:$_SESSION['變數名'] = 「值」; 銷毀變數:unset($_SESSION['變數名'])www.10086zg.com回答

熱點內容
密碼子的原料是什麼 發布:2024-09-19 09:11:42 瀏覽:347
半夜編程 發布:2024-09-19 09:11:36 瀏覽:103
海康威視存儲卡質量如何 發布:2024-09-19 08:55:35 瀏覽:940
python3默認安裝路徑 發布:2024-09-19 08:50:22 瀏覽:516
環衛視頻拍攝腳本 發布:2024-09-19 08:35:44 瀏覽:418
sqlserveronlinux 發布:2024-09-19 08:16:54 瀏覽:256
編程常數 發布:2024-09-19 08:06:36 瀏覽:952
甘肅高性能邊緣計算伺服器雲空間 發布:2024-09-19 08:06:26 瀏覽:162
win7家庭版ftp 發布:2024-09-19 07:59:06 瀏覽:717
資料庫的優化都有哪些方法 發布:2024-09-19 07:44:43 瀏覽:269